Crops are actually historically a supply of analgesic alkaloids, While their pharmacological characterization is usually limited. Among the these types of purely natural analgesic molecules, conolidine, present in the bark with the tropical flowering shrub Tabernaemontana divaricata, also called pinwheel flower or crepe jasmine, has extensive been Utilized in regular Chinese, Ayurvedic and Thai medicines to treat fever and pain4 (Fig. 1a). Pharmacologists have only recently been in a position to verify its medicinal and pharmacological Attributes because of its initial asymmetric whole synthesis.five Conolidine can be a uncommon C5-nor stemmadenine (Fig. 1b), which shows potent analgesia in in vivo models of tonic and persistent pain and decreases inflammatory pain relief. It had been also proposed that conolidine-induced analgesia may possibly lack difficulties normally linked to classical opioid prescription drugs.

The next pain phase is due to an inflammatory response, whilst the principal reaction is acute harm into the nerve fibers. Conolidine injection was found to suppress both the section 1 and 2 pain reaction (60). This implies conolidine proficiently suppresses both equally chemically or inflammatory pain of both equally an acute and persistent character. Additional analysis by Tarselli et al. identified conolidine to possess no affinity Conolidine Proleviate for myofascial pain syndrome for the mu-opioid receptor, suggesting a unique mode of action from traditional opiate analgesics. Furthermore, this review uncovered which the drug will not change locomotor exercise in mice topics, suggesting a lack of side effects like sedation or addiction found in other dopamine-advertising and marketing substances (sixty).
